About this course

Through this course, students will gain hands-on experience in cutting-edge VFX techniques, learning from industry experts who are passionate about fostering diversity and inclusion. The curriculum covers essential topics such as color grading, compositing, rotoscoping, and match moving. By completing this program, learners will not only acquire the technical abilities necessary for success in the VFX industry but also develop a strong understanding of the unique challenges and opportunities that come with creating authentic LGBTQ+ media. As companies increasingly prioritize diversity and inclusion, this certificate will give graduates a competitive edge in the job market, opening doors to exciting career opportunities in film, television, gaming, and more.
